Artist of the Week
The Jack Straw Artist of the Week Podcast highlights work created through the Artist Residency Programs at Jack Straw Cultural Center.-
Karin Kajita Jazz Quintet - Just Born Lucky
Karin Kajita recorded the album Letting Go with her jazz quintet during her 2006 Jack Straw artist residency.
